Sri Lanka - Agricultural Use of Herbicides
Since 2014, Sri Lanka Agricultural Use of Herbicides grew 46.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 62 among other countries in Agricultural Use of Herbicides with 1,095 Metric Tons. Sri Lanka is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 61 at 1,112 Metric Tons and is followed by Sweden at 1,086 Metric Tons. United States topped the ranking with 259,537 Metric Tons in 2019, a growth of 1.5% versus 2018. Brazil, Argentina and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iraq witnessed the best average annual growth at +112.7% per year, while Lesotho wit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
